"After nearly 10 days in Spain touring all over the country, we needed a respite from ‘Spanish Food’. Let’s establish that we are from New York/New Jersey and anyone who has been there knows how seriously we take our Pizza. However, cannot express how pleased we were with our experience at La Pizza de Andre. While the place was a bit of a challenge to find and park, that was the only thing about the visit that was not fabulous. Full of locals when we arrived, the place has a charming outdoor patio, and the service was warm and attentive. For starters, we had a mixed salad that was a welcome change from the local cuisine. Spinach, arugula, olives, onion and tomato, adorned with some tuna…..just delicious. Next up was the pizza….they have 50 signature pies with a wide range of toppings. We chose a white pie with arugula, mozzarella and straciatella that was thin crispy and delicious. Followed that up with a red pie with mushrooms and onions, equally as scrumptious. I fancy my pizza with some heat, and they offer both a chili infused olive oil as well as some fiery crushed red peppers that were just what the doctor prescribed after a week of very savory (and at times, bland) local cuisine. Add to that a small, but well curated selection of wines, and, I can see why this pizzeria was rated numero uno in Marbella. In fact, they would give some of New York’s best a run for their money. Needless to say—HIGHLY RECOMMENDED."
